Ian Evatt is in no doubt that defender George Johnston will be able to cope with the occasion of playing against old side Wigan Athletic in the heart of defence for Bolton Wanderers.
The 23-year-old has become a first choice selection for Wanderers after joining in the summer transfer window, sparking up a partnership with Ricardo Almeida Santos.
He spent the second half of last season on loan at the Latics as he helped the club remain in League One, making 22 appearances and scoring once in the process.
